Understanding Baby Club Benefits

Parents join baby clubs to achieve several key objectives. The most prominent benefit is financial savings, which can be realized through discounts on items like diapers, formula, and clothing. Another significant advantage is product sampling, allowing parents to try different brands of baby food, formula, or skincare before committing to a full-sized purchase. Many clubs also provide access to resources such as parenting tips, informational articles, and expert advice. Furthermore, some programs foster a sense of community, enabling parents to connect with others and share experiences. Finally, members often receive exclusive offers, deals, and promotions that are not available to the general public.

Amazon Family

Amazon Family provides members with significant daily discounts on baby essentials. Members receive 20% off diapers and wipes, 40% off children’s books, 20% off baby food, and 15% off household items. The membership also includes unlimited streaming of movies, TV, and music, along with free two-day shipping. A free 30-day trial is available, after which the service continues unless canceled.

Enfamil Family Beginnings

Enfamil Family Beginnings offers free formula samples, coupons, personalized tips, and resources. The requirements for joining are basic information about the parent and the baby’s expected or actual birth date. The source notes an upgrade option to Enfamil Premium, which includes $700 worth of Enfamil products in addition to the standard welcome gift. A free sample of Enfagrow Toddler formula is also available through a separate link.

Medela The Mom’s Room

Medela’s “The Mom’s Room” is a support club for breastfeeding mothers. Members receive a free sample box containing breast milk storage bags, disposable nursing pads, a micro-steam bag, and lanolin cream. The source also mentions the availability of a free Medela Breast Pump through a separate offer.

General and Specific Requirements

Requirements for joining baby clubs vary by program. Many, such as Enfamil Family Beginnings, require basic information about the parent and the baby’s expected or actual birth date. Some clubs, like Baby Box University, require the completion of online parenting classes to receive rewards. Retailer-specific clubs, such as those at Target or BuyBuy Baby, typically require the creation of a baby registry. For clubs offering physical products, a shipping fee may apply, as seen with Your Baby Club, Baby Einstein, and Kabrita. It is important to note that some programs, like Heinz Baby Club, are only available in Canada.

Maximizing Membership Benefits

To maximize benefits from baby clubs, parents should consider joining multiple programs to increase the variety of samples and discounts received. Paying attention to special offers, such as the refer-a-friend programs from Hello Bello and Kabrita, can provide additional value. For clubs requiring a shipping fee, the value of the received products should be weighed against the cost. Utilizing retailer-specific clubs, especially those where you already shop, can lead to consistent savings on everyday items.
